Points were back in fashion last week in the NFL as nine of the 13 games went ‘over’ the total. This marked a return to the trend in the first two weeks of the regular season when over 70 percent of the games went ‘over’ the total line.

The odds makers have done a good job at keeping the lines sharp this season and last week was no exception. Seven favorites and six underdogs each won against the spread and seven home teams and six road teams did the same. We cashed on Oakland’s straight-up win over Houston as a six-point road underdog and benefitted from an early spread of 9.5 points on the Jets (this line actually closed at 7.5 points on most books). The lone setback of the week was New Orleans, as it could not cover the 6.5 points against Carolina.

The number of top 25 teams in the SEC has been reduced to five after Florida fell out of the rankings when it lost its second straight conference game by a large margin. When it comes to conference records, No. 15 South Carolina and Georgia lead the East Division at 3-1, while the West Division features the top two teams in the nation, No.1 LSU and No.2 Alabama at 3-0. The other two ranked teams in the SEC- West are No.10 Arkansas at 1-1 and No.24 Auburn at 2-1.
